# 30896: Campaign vetting rejection - Opt-in Error

Log Type: APPLICATION

Log Level: ERROR

## Description

The campaign submission has been reviewed and it was rejected because of provided Opt-in information.

### Possible causes

* Opt-in message workflow does not meet the requirements for the specific campaign type.
* Consent is required but not adequately provided or maintained.
* Opt-in information is shared with third-party entities.

### Possible solutions

1. Ensure compliance with Twilio Messaging Policy relating to opt-in
2. Detail All Opt-in Methods: Include all methods of opt-in, whether electronic, paper form, in-person verbal opt-in, or other means.
3. Provide Necessary Links and Documentation: If opt-in is collected through a paper form or behind a login, supply a hosted link to an image of the opt-in. If the opt-in occurs on a website, provide the relevant link.
4. Include Privacy Policy and Terms of Service: The website where opt-in occurs must contain a privacy policy and terms of service.
5. Avoid Third-Party Sharing: Make sure that opt-in information is not shared with unauthorized third parties.
6. Ensure Opt-in is Verifable: Each campaign is manually reviewed and needs to be verifable by a human.

Once you have made a change to address the issue, please resubmit the campaign for review.
